Three.js Animation

Three.js is a cross-browser JavaScript library and Application Programming Interface (API) used to create and display animated 3D computer graphics in a web browser.

#What is Three.js?

Three.js is a popular and widely-used JavaScript library that makes it easy to create and display 3D animations and graphics on the web. With Three.js, developers can create complex and immersive visual experiences that can be rendered in real-time and interacted with by users.

#Three.js Key Features

Here are some of the most recognizable features of Three.js Animation:

  • Support for a wide range of 3D formats and data types, including textures, materials, and geometry.
  • A robust set of tools for creating and manipulating 3D scenes, including cameras, lights, and controls for moving and rotating objects.
  • Built-in support for a variety of 3D effects and animations, including particle systems, post-processing effects, and morph targets.
  • High-performance rendering engine that leverages the power of WebGL to deliver smooth and responsive animations and graphics.
  • Active and supportive community with many resources available, including tutorials, examples, and plugins.
  • Compatibility with other popular libraries and frameworks, such as React and Vue.js.

#Three.js Use-Cases

Here are some common use cases for Three.js Animation:

  • Creating interactive and engaging visual experiences for websites and applications, such as product demonstrations, games, and virtual tours.
  • Building data visualizations and infographics that can be explored and interacted with in 3D.
  • Developing augmented and virtual reality applications that can be experienced through a web browser.

#Three.js Summary

Three.js Animation is a powerful and flexible JavaScript library that enables developers to create stunning 3D animations and graphics on the web, with support for a wide range of 3D formats and data types, a robust set of tools for creating and manipulating 3D scenes, and compatibility with other popular libraries and frameworks.

Hix logo

Try hix.dev now

Simplify project configuration.
DRY during initialization.
Prevent the technical debt, easily.

We use cookies, please read and accept our Cookie Policy.